Pattern Description:
A cowl-necked top or pullover
Pattern Sizing:
34-42
Did it look like the photo/drawing on the pattern envelope once you were done sewing with it?
Absolutely!
Were the instructions easy to follow?
The instructions were brilliantly easy to follow, particularly since there's only 3 pieces to this pattern!
What did you particularly like or dislike about the pattern?
I like cowl necklines, and the ruching on the sleeves and the asymmetrical lines created by the elastic in the right side seam create an interesting shape.
Fabric Used:
wool sweater knit
Pattern alterations or any design changes you made:
I usually do an FBA, but I didn't for this because there is a lot of stretch in this semi-sheer sweater knit. It's super warm, too, which surprised me because it is so lightweight and airy.
I sewed a straight size down from my usual size with the only change to the instructions being to extend the elastic in the side seam higher than intended in order to get a proportionate look for my short-waisted torso.
I found this to be very generously sized, and if you prefer a tighter fit, definitely go down two sizes. Since I'm entering that phase of life where extra stuff seems to like my waist, I left it a little looser fitting.
Would you sew it again? Would you recommend it to others?
I would recommend this because it's simple to sew and a great twist on a typical pullover.
